Excuses VS Action: What’s Holding Back Your Startup?

Are doubts and excuses holding you back from launching your own business?

Benjamin Franklin once said “He that is good at making excuses is seldom good at anything else”.

What if you spent all of the time you did doubting your desire to start your own venture or if you can really make it work actually figuring out how to get around those obstacles? Not sure how to attack a certain challenge or get over a specific hurdle? Why not get out and network with those who have already done it? Define what you need to learn or do to make your business idea a success and get out there and do it.

It is good to listen to some of the warnings your mind sends you, but being paralyzed by these fears is not. Isn’t it better to try and have the opportunity to fulfill your dreams than to hide under a rock and regret it for the rest of your life?

Vincent Van Gogh, put it like this, “If you hear a voice within you say ‘you cannot paint,’ then by all means paint, and that voice will be silenced”.

So what is it that you are afraid of? Attack it now. Then everything else will be easier.
